A regal, full 3D sculpt embodying the vibrant artistry and celebratory spirit of Día de los Muertos.

The Monarch Calavera Skull Mask is a spectacular piece of cultural decor. This deep-sculpted model features exquisite detail, including roses woven across the crown, intricate scrollwork over the face, and pronounced cheekbones and eye sockets. It's perfect as a dramatic wall hanging or a centerpiece for ceremonial display.

 

 

Design Features

 

This model is defined by its Full 3D, Deep Sculpt, which provides realistic anatomical curves and a pronounced presence. It features Exquisite Floral Accents and fine scrollwork that reflects high-end Calavera artistry. Due to the complex nature of the full mask lying flat, supports are Required to hold the facial contours and preserve the shape. Its highly detailed surface is ideal for multi-color finishing, and it includes an integrated method for hanging.

Creative Finishing Suggestions

 

For finishing ideas, achieve a Traditional Ceramic Look by applying a white base coat and then using highly saturated, glossy acrylic colors (teal, magenta, yellow) on the scrollwork and flowers. Create a Matte Altar Piece by using muted pastel colors with a chalky matte finish. Alternatively, apply a Gemstone Effect to the roses and eyes using translucent paints over metallic silver for high visual impact.

 

Printing Protocol: Recommended Settings

 

For structural stability and adherence to the design specifications, this complex model must be printed flat on the build plate (face up).

SettingRecommendationNotes
PrinterFDM (Bambu A1 Recommended)Excellent detail resolution for full 3D figures.
MaterialPLA+ / PLA ProBest balance of detail retention and structure.
Layer Height0.16mmRecommended standard for maximum detail and quality.
Infill10%Sufficient internal structure for stability.
SupportsRequired (Extensive)Necessary to support the floating contours of the nose, chin, and brow when printing flat.
OrientationFlat on Bed (Face Up)Required orientation for this specific model; maximizes print bed adhesion.
